10825 Yonge St, Richmond Hill, ON
Electronics store chain specializing in computers and accessories, mobile devices through Best Buy Mobile, TVs and home theatre, video games, and many other product categories. Customers can reserve products online and pick up in-store ...
Read more
50 Newkirk Road, Richmond Hill, ON
For owners and contractors who recognize the value of superior performance, Innocon offers technologically designed products, available nowhere else in the GTA.